Output 50c9968c89549a2da791b2d63bf43bfab5174c2c99b70e02e6f99964de0583b0:8

value
854066
script pubkey
OP_0 OP_PUSHBYTES_20 443c0674a3066e8ce93def88ebe56d2fd458b871
address
bc1qgs7qva9rqehge6faa7ywhetd9l293wr3ww066x
transaction
50c9968c89549a2da791b2d63bf43bfab5174c2c99b70e02e6f99964de0583b0
confirmations
230662
spent
true